From: David Brownell Date: Mon, 2 Nov 2009 01:34:52 +0000 (-0800) Subject: doxygen: avoid most internals X-Git-Tag: v0.3.0~15 X-Git-Url: https://review.openocd.org/gitweb?p=openocd.git;a=commitdiff_plain;h=13e264426c5933ee3aa241c4f63feedf8f49b128 doxygen: avoid most internals For some reason, all the interals are documented by default. This is wrong for two basic reasons:  - We need to focus on public interfaces, since those are the architectural interfaces and relationships.  - Since virtually nothing has doxygen support yet, this    maximizes the noise, and minimizes the usefulness of doxygen output. So don't expose so much by default. --- diff --git a/Doxyfile.in b/Doxyfile.in index 0b204a096b..038f1e556d 100644 --- a/Doxyfile.in +++ b/Doxyfile.in @@ -307,13 +307,13 @@ EXTRACT_PRIVATE = NO # If the EXTRACT_STATIC tag is set to YES all static members of a file # will be included in the documentation. -EXTRACT_STATIC = YES +EXTRACT_STATIC = NO # If the EXTRACT_LOCAL_CLASSES tag is set to YES classes (and structs) # defined locally in source files will be included in the documentation. # If set to NO only classes defined in header files are included. -EXTRACT_LOCAL_CLASSES = YES +EXTRACT_LOCAL_CLASSES = NO # This flag is only useful for Objective-C code. When set to YES local # methods, which are defined in the implementation section but not in